PROGRAM OBJECTIVE

The Emergency Medical Assistance (EMA) Program is a Tribal Program that provides assistance to Creek Citizens in obtaining prescribed medical equipment necessary to sustain health and well being when no other resource is available. This program is designed to assist the Creek Citizens and isn't intended to cover the total cost of prescriptions and related expenses.

 


ELIGIBILITY REQUIREMENTS

v     Applicants must provide proof of Citizenship by furnishing a copy of their Tribal Enrollment Card. Any minor under the age of one (1) shall have an enrolled parent and be enrollment eligible.

v     Applicant must be on file as a patient OR establish a patient file with Muscogee (Creek) Nation Health System.

v     Applicant must present the original prescription and a statement from the Tribal or Indian Health Service Health Facility that the prescription or a reasonable alternative prescription is unavailable at those facilities.

v     Applicant is to make an application and have prior approval through the Medical Assistance Program on prescriptions that are obtained outside the Muscogee (Creek) Nation Health System.

v     The applicant must furnish documentation, which verifies all other available resources (Medicaid, Medicare, Private Insurance, etc.) have been exhausted.

 


BENEFIT AMOUNT

v     A grant of $1,000 per year (365 days YTD) for Health Maintenance medications and Medical Equipment. (Oxygen, concentrators, nebulizers, walkers, hearing aid, etc.)

v     A grant of $2,500 per year (365 days YTD) for Life Sustaining Medications only (cancer, dialysis, heart related, etc.)

v     A grant up to $4,000 for eligible applicants (one time only) for prosthesis (artificial limbs)
